Jacksonville University College of Law receives ABA provisional accreditation
Jacksonville University College of Law has achieved ABA provisional accreditation. The law school’s third entering class will begin their studies this August, as the college of law moves to its permanent location at 121 W. Forsyth St. in the heart of downtown Jacksonville. Measure to assist victims of domestic violence obtain protective orders poised for passage
Rep. Alina Garcia The Legislature is expected to sign off today on a measure that would make it easier for domestic violence victims to seek a protective order.
